2. Understanding the Factors That Affect Your Car Insurance Rates

Several factors influence the cost of your car insurance premiums. These include:

  • Your Driving Record: A clean driving record can lead to lower premiums, while accidents and violations can increase your rates.
  • The Type of Car You Drive: High-performance or luxury cars typically cost more to insure than economy models.
  • Your Geographic Location: Urban areas with higher rates of accidents and thefts often have higher insurance rates.
  • Age and Gender: Statistically, certain age groups and genders are considered higher risk.
  • Credit Score: In many states, insurers use your credit score to help determine your premium rates.

Understanding these factors can help you manage your expectations and potentially lower your costs.

3. How to Compare Car Insurance Quotes Effectively

Comparing car insurance quotes doesn’t have to be complicated. Follow these steps to ensure you’re getting the best deal:

  • Gather Information: Have your vehicle information, driving record, and any other relevant details handy.
  • Use Online Tools: Leverage online comparison tools to get multiple quotes at once.
  • Check Coverage Options: Make sure you’re comparing similar coverage. Pay attention to deductibles, limits, and exclusions.
  • Read Reviews: Look at customer reviews to gauge the insurer’s service quality and claim handling.

4. Tips for Lowering Your Car Insurance Premiums

To reduce your car insurance costs, consider the following tips:

  • Increase Your Deductible: Agreeing to pay a higher deductible can lower your premiums.
  • Look for Discounts: Many insurers offer discounts for things like safe driving, multiple vehicles, or security features in your car.
  • Drive Less: Consider usage-based insurance if you’re a low-mileage driver.
  • Improve Your Credit Score: Work on enhancing your credit score if it’s used in your state to determine rates.

5. The Importance of Reading the Fine Print in Car Insurance Policies

It’s crucial to understand what your car insurance policy covers and what it doesn’t. Pay close attention to:

  • Exclusions: These are situations or events that your policy does not cover.
  • Limits: Be aware of the maximum amount your insurer will pay for different types of claims.
  • Terms and Conditions: Understanding these can help avoid surprises when you file a claim.

6. How Technology is Changing Car Insurance Quotes

Technology has significantly transformed how consumers shop for and manage their car insurance. Innovations include:

  • Online Comparison Tools: These platforms allow you to compare quotes from multiple insurers quickly.
  • Telematics: Devices that monitor your driving habits can lead to discounts for safe driving.
  • Mobile Apps: Many insurers now offer apps that streamline everything from getting quotes to filing claims.
